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,241,271, issued on March 4.
"Cord adjusting assembly" was invented by Long Xiang Shen (San Bernardino, Calif.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A cord adjusting assembly for a cover includes an affixing body including a front receiving slot and a rear receiving slot; a rotatable shaft coupled to the affixing body; a cord attached to the cover; wherein the front receiving slot, the rear receiving slot, and the rotatable shaft are cooperated with the cord to tighten or loosen the cord."
The patent was filed on Dec. 14, 2023, under Application No. 18/540,741.
